Kensington Orbit Dual Wireless Ergonomic Trackball Mouse - Black
Kensington's Orbit Trackball is designed for comfort and productivity, reducing wrist movement to ...Kensington's Orbit Trackball is designed for comfort and productivity, reducing wrist movement to help prevent repetitive strain injuries. Effortlessly scroll through pages by spinning the dial. Its ambidextrous design suits both right-handed and left-handed users. Customize your experience with 4 DPI levels for precise control, and use KensingtonWorks software to reassign button functions. The detachable wrist rest provides extra comfort for long work sessions. Connect wirelessly via 2.4 GHz or Bluetooth for cable-free use. Optical tracking ensures accurate and swift navigation.
